While you were sleeping ECB cuts euro-zone growth for 2013

The euro weakened against the US dollar and the yen after European Central Bank President Mario Draghi said the euro-zone was expected to stay in recession next year, reversing an earlier forecast for a recovery in economic growth. The downgrade to the outlook for gross domestic product came as the ECB left its benchmark interest rate at a record low …

Wynyard gets toehold in US market with Northrop Grumman tie-up

Wynyard Group, the security and risk management software firm owned by Jade Software, has got a toehold in the US, partnering with Virginia-based Northrop Grumman Corp. The deal gives Wynyard access to a US$2 billion market, which accounts for about half the global market in security and risk management software, and will give the New Zealand firm a foot in …
